Editorial Reviews

Product Description
This is a hands-on introduction to modeling a wide variety of applications in Microsoft Excel. It features numerous tutorials and applications to illustrate how to model and solve problems in Excel. Neuwirth and Arganbright offer a more accessible and hands-on alternative than do other modeling books. Illustrated examples provide instruction in concepts, applications, and methods of solving them.

About the Author
Erich Neuwirth is a professor of mathematics and statistics at the University of Vienna. He has authored numerous contributed papers on the subject of using spreadsheets to help visualize structures. He maintains a wealth of valuable resources on this subject at http://sunsite.univie.ac.at/spreadsite/

Deane Arganbright is currently Professor and Chair of the Department of Mathematics and Statistics at the University of Tennessee at Martin. Previously, he taught at Iowa State University, Whitworth College, and the University of Papua New Guinea. He has also authored MATHEMATICAL APPLICATIONS OF ELECTRONIC SPREADSHEETS, and PRACTICAL HANDBOOK OF SPREADSHEET CURVES AND GEOMETRIC CONSTRUCTIONS.

5.0 out of 5 stars An ideal text for those modeling with Excell, February 3, 2004
By A Customer
This text is a softcover, even though at this time Amazon still lists it as a thin hardcover. It is written on the same level as Giordano, Wier and Fox's Mathematical Modelling, but focuses directly on the use of Microsoft's Excell. I am one of the many annoyed with Microsoft, but since Excell is ubiquitious, it makes a reasonable choice for a course. The book is very visual showing, for example, how to use Excell to draw Feigenbaum diagrams to illustrate chaos, how to illustrating Newton's method (drawing the tangent lines...), drawing Bezier curves for smoothing... It points out many of Excell's useful features (some have found just learning how to add scrollbars useful).
